QUEENSLANDRACING INTEGRITY COMMISSION

STEWARDS REPORT

IPSWICH TURF CLUB

MONDAY 5 MAY 2025

WEATHER – Fine  TRACK RATING –  Good 4         RAIL – +10m entire
PENETROMETER – 5.15

OFFICIALS

Stewards – B. Wright (Chair,) E. Scott, K. Lemay-Robbins, A. Dowsett, H. Matthews


GENERAL

Stewards permitted the following overweights:
 
Race 1: Jockey B. Lerena +0.5kg (55.5kg)
Race 4: Jockey B. Lerena +0.5kg (55.5kg)
 
Trainer L. Gough was fined $200 under LR67(1) for the raceday declaration of Jockey A. Jones as the rider of SKORPIOS ISLE in Race 4.
 
Rider R. Maloney was not riding today due to transport difficulties and was replaced as per the raceday summary.

Race 3: BARRIER REEF POOLS MAIDEN PLATE         2210 M

PURE THOUGHTS – Near the 1400m, got its head up when being steadied from the heels of BRAVE HOSHI. Held up for a run from the 500m until 300m. Near the 200m, steadied when awkwardly placed close to the heels of STATE OF AFFAIRS (K. Wilson-Taylor,) which shifted in under pressure. Rider K. Wilson-Taylor was advised to exercise greater care when shifting ground.
 
SMELTER (IRE) – Near the 2000m, was hampered when tightened between PURE THOUGHTS and STATE OF AFFAIRS, which was carried in when awkwardly placed towards the heels of BRAVE HOSHI (L. Tarrant), which shifted in when not quite clear. Rider L. Tarrant was reprimanded under AR 131(a) for careless riding. Rider M. Hellyer reported the gelding raced keenly in the early and middle stages and would not settle.
 
SPACE JOURNEY – Raced 3 wide without cover from the 1200m. A post-race veterinary examination identified the presence of blood at both nostrils. Trainer J. Townsend was notified that in accordance with AR79(4), SPACE JOURNEY shall not without permission of the Stewards: (a) be trained, exercised or galloped on any racecourse, recognised training track, private training establishment, or other place for a period of two months; (b) start in any race for a period of 3 months, and then only after: (i) a gallop of at least 1000 metres; or (ii) an official trial or jump-out; in the presence, and to the satisfaction of a Steward. 
 
 
FLAMING GENESIS – Raced 4 wide without cover from the 700m.
 
NOT A WORRY (NZ) – Change of tactics - attempt to lead. Led.

Race 6: THE IPSWICH TRIBUNE BENCHMARK 62 HANDICAP 1710 M

 
ZAYNUDIN (IRE) – For several strides near the 100m, raced in restricted room between TAREX (NZ) and BETTER YET, before obtaining clear running passing the 50m.
 
SHE'S GOT VEUVE – Rider K. Wilson-Taylor reported the mare had come to the end of its preparation. Passing the 50m, steadied when racing in restricted room between TAREX (NZ) and DEEP DAWN. A post-race veterinary examination revealed no apparent abnormalities. Trainer representative B. Killian advised the mare would now be going for a spell.
 
GURU CLASS – After being caught 3 wide without cover passing the 1400m, was allowed to stride and join the leader near the 900m. Rider A. Jones explained her intention was to allow DEEP DAWN, the expected leader, to cross to the rail approaching the 1400m and then sit outside that mare in the early stages, however; when DEEP DAWN crossed her mount, the rider then steadied and remained off the rail in front of GURU CLASS. She said she was then obliged to take hold of her mount and at the same time GIFTED GAMER shifted from a wider position to take up the one out, one back position she had intended. She added she was then obliged to race wide without cover before allowing the mare to stride and join the leader passing the 900m.
